The allure of starting a small business is undeniable – being your own boss, pursuing your passion, and controlling your destiny. However, one question often looms large: “What are the most profitable small businesses?” While profits are influenced by numerous factors, certain industries and business models tend to offer higher earning potential. Let’s dive into some lucrative options for aspiring entrepreneurs.

Have you ever dreamed of opening a restaurant or café, only to be deterred by the notoriously slim profit margins? Well, fear not! There are numerous profitable small business opportunities that don’t involve grueling kitchen hours or managing a large staff.

Consulting and Professional Services

In today’s fast-paced world, businesses of all sizes are outsourcing specialized services to experts. As a consultant or professional service provider, you can leverage your expertise and experience to command premium rates. Whether you’re a marketing guru, IT whiz, or financial wizard, offering your knowledge as a service can be a highly profitable venture.

Home Services

From lawn care and landscaping to house cleaning and handyman services, the home services industry offers a plethora of profitable opportunities. These businesses often have low overhead costs and cater to a constant demand from homeowners seeking assistance with maintenance and repairs.

Online Businesses

The internet has opened up a world of possibilities for entrepreneurs. From e-commerce stores to software as a service (SaaS) platforms, online businesses can be incredibly lucrative. With a global customer base and minimal physical infrastructure, the potential for scalability and profitability is immense.

Real Estate

While real estate investing requires capital upfront, it can be an incredibly lucrative endeavor. From flipping houses to rental properties, savvy real estate entrepreneurs can build substantial wealth through strategic acquisitions and value-added renovations.

Scalable Products or Services

Businesses that offer products or services with the potential for scalability tend to be more profitable in the long run. For instance, a software developer can create a product once and sell it repeatedly, generating recurring revenue streams.

Niche Markets

Identifying and serving a niche market can be a game-changer for small businesses. By catering to a specific demographic or need, you can position yourself as an expert and command premium prices for your specialized offerings.

While these are just a few examples, the key to profitability lies in finding a business model that aligns with your skills, interests, and market demand. Conduct thorough research, develop a solid business plan, and be prepared to work hard and adapt to market changes.

Remember, profitability is not just about the industry you choose; it’s also about your ability to efficiently manage costs, provide exceptional value to your customers, and continuously innovate and evolve your offerings.

So, if you’re ready to embark on the entrepreneurial journey, don’t let the fear of low profits hold you back. With the right strategy, determination, and a willingness to adapt, you can build a thriving and profitable small business in a variety of industries.
